Britain will succeed in securing significant reform of its relationship with the European Union, according to its finance minister George Osborne.
He's used a keynote speech at the Conservative Party Conference in Manchester to insist the EU must change, or face stagnation.
UK Prime Minister David Cameron has promised to win reform of the EU before holding a referendum on Britain's membership of it.
But some member states are threatening to block his reform plans.
Chancellor George Osborne says there is no option.
